SOUTH KOREA TO BUY ISRAELI EARLY WARNING RADAR TO DETER NORTH

-

South Korea plans to buy two Israeli early warning radar systems, it said yesterday, as it reinforces air defenses against North Korea despite fast-improving relations. The decision to adopt the two Green Pine Block C radar systems, built by ELTA Systems, a subsidiary of state-owned Israel Aerospace Industries, was made at a defense acquisitio­n committee, Seoul’s arms procuremen­t agency, DAPA, said. The project is intended to boost South Korea’s capabiliti­es to “detect and track ballistic missiles from a long distance at an early stage,” DAPA said in a statement. It did not mention North Korea.
